Artist Statement
Art gives me a way in which to express my quirky personality, to give people who may not know me a sense of who I am through the work I create. For my work, I take a basic idea or thing, like fruit, and add my own creative flair to it. This is what allows me to express my individuality through humor and absurdity, and what differentiates myself from other artists. This process of working with a basic idea and then personalizing it holds true for whatever medium I work with, as I tend to make mixed-media or video projects as often as I do photography.
I don’t seek to inspire people with my art as much as force them to look at something in a way in which they might not have before, like seeing my pictures of fruit and silently thinking, “Hehe, that guy is silly, fruits don’t have faces”. Everyone needs a bit of immaturity in their life anyway. I don’t really care if you like my art or not, I just hope that it amuses you.
